Taylor Secures Victory Over Serrano in Thrilling Trilogy Bout

Katie Taylor Prevails in Third Epic Clash Against Amanda Serrano

New York City – Katie Taylor cemented her legacy as one of the greatest women’s boxers of all time, securing a majority decision victory over Amanda Serrano at Madison Square Garden on Friday. The bout concluded a captivating trilogy between two titans of the sport, captivating fans worldwide and showcasing the growing prominence of women’s boxing.

The hard-fought contest took place on a night dedicated to women’s championship boxing, featuring five title fights and a total of 17 championships on the line. Taylor’s win allows her to retain her status as a top contender, currently ranked second, only slightly behind undisputed heavyweight champion Claressa Shields.

Shifting Dynamics in the Rankings

Serrano remains a formidable force, holding onto the third position in the rankings, narrowly ahead of Chantelle Cameron. Cameron,notably the only fighter to have defeated Taylor,successfully defended her interim junior welterweight title,possibly setting the stage for a future,highly anticipated trilogy with Taylor.

Alycia Baumgardner demonstrated her dominance by retaining her undisputed junior lightweight title, climbing one spot to number seven. Ellie Scotney made a striking debut at number ten,having unified three junior featherweight titles with a decisive victory over Yamileth Mercado.

Current Top 10 Women’s Boxers

Here’s a look at the current top ten rankings as of November 2, 2025:

Rank Fighter Record Division Last Fight
1 claressa Shields 17-0, 3 KOs Undisputed Heavyweight W (UD10) Lani Daniels, July 26
2 Katie Taylor 25-1, 6 KOs Undisputed Junior Welterweight W (MD10) Amanda Serrano, July 11
3 Amanda Serrano 47-4-1, 31 KOs Unified Featherweight L (MD10) Katie Taylor, July 11
4 Chantelle Cameron 21-1, 8 KOs Junior Welterweight W (UD10) Jessica Camara, July 11
5 Gabriela Fundora 17-0, 9 kos Undisputed Flyweight W (KO7) Alexas Kubicki, sept. 20
6 Mikaela Mayer 22-2, 5 KOs Welterweight/Junior Middleweight W (UD10) Mary Spencer, Oct. 30
7 Alycia Baumgardner 16-1,7 KOs Unified Junior Lightweight W (UD10) Jennifer Miranda,July 11
8 Lauren Price 9-0,2 KOs Unified Welterweight W (UD10) Natasha Jonas,March 7
9 Yokasta Valle 33-3,10 KOs Strawweight W (SD10) Marlen Esparza,March 29
10 Ellie Scotney 11-0,0 KOs Undisputed Junior Featherweight W (UD10) yamileth Mercado,July 11

The Evolution of Women’s Boxing

The sport of women’s boxing has come a long way from being a niche interest to gaining mainstream recognition. Initially facing meaningful barriers to entry, including limited opportunities and societal biases, female boxers are now headlining major events and commanding substantial viewership.

This progress is a testament to the perseverance of pioneering athletes and the increasing demand for diverse sporting content.As the talent pool continues to grow, the future of women’s boxing appears brighter than ever, promising more thrilling matchups and inspiring stories.
